Monsterz is a little arcade puzzle game, similar to the famous or Zookeeper.
The goal of the game is to create rows of similar monsters, either horizontally or vertically. The only allowed move is the swap of two adjacent monsters, on the condition that it creates a row of three or more. When alignments are cleared, pieces fall from the top of the screen to fill the board again. Chain reactions earn you even more points.
This game is mostly about luck, but it remains highly addictive. You have been warned.
Currently three modes are available:
Classic - play against the clock and clear a given number of each monster type to reach next level.
Puzzle - clear lines of monsters to move pieces around and put together the puzzle.
Training - play against the clock in a neverending level, chose the timer difficulty and number of monsters for infinite fun.
Monsterz is completely free software, available under the terms of the WTFPL. It was written by the following people:
Sam Hocevar (programming, graphics, sound FX)
Brendan Rackley (UI programming)
MenTaLguY (music)
Sun Microsystems, Inc., Michael Speck, David White & the Battle of Wesnoth project, Mike Kershaw (sound FX)
